2013-10-18 45 views
0

我有一个nvidia显卡,并能够安装cuda过去。最近我重新安装了linux(Ubuntu 12.04),并试图使用debian软件包安装cuda。我遵循Youtube上的Nvidia cudacast频道(http://www.youtube.com/watch?v=lVzSullC9l8)的指示来安装cuda工具包。cuda debian安装更新 - 替代错误

后,我开始与我的sudo-apt-get install cuda我得到以下错误:

Setting up nvidia-current (319.37-0ubuntu1) ... 
update-alternatives: error: alternative link /usr/bin/nvidia-cuda-mps-server is already managed by x86_64-linux-gnu_nvidia-cuda-mps-server (slave of x86_64-linux-gnu_gl_conf). 
dpkg: error processing nvidia-current (--configure): 
subprocess installed post-installation script returned error exit status 2 

看起来这可能与具有Ubuntu的建议默认安装以前的Nvidia驱动。我尝试使用软件中心卸载所有内容,但仍然没有运气。

任何帮助?

+0

此外,cuda-cast建议尝试/ usr/bin/nvidia-uninstall,但我找不到它们。 cuda-cast中的说明与此处的相匹配:http://docs.nvidia.com/cuda/cuda-getting-started-guide-for-linux/index.html – Rajiv

+0

对于谁推倒了问题,它会如果你解释了为什么会有帮助。我可以通过这种方式改善我的问题。 – Rajiv

+0

Stackoverflow用于编程问题,而不是驱动程序安装问题。你的问题是脱离主题。我没有倒下,但是你的问题应该关闭,我投票结束。改用超级用户或askubuntu这样的论坛。 –

回答

6

我想通了这个问题。尽管我已经从软件中心卸载,但仍然安装了旧的Nvidia软件。我得到了使用摆脱他们:

sudo apt-get remove --purge nvidia-* 

然后我确信,Ubuntu的仍然有桌面软件包

sudo apt-get install ubuntu-desktop 

我再重新启动,并使用安装在整个CUDA工具包:

sudo apt-get install cuda 

那为我做了。